Summary
Compelling talks followed by picnicking and convivial stargazing through both the big telescopes.
This month features a movie night, with a presentation of short film treasures from the National Film Board of Canada and experimental filmmakers whose work explored the intersection of Art and Science.

Description
Evening Schedule:
- The night begins at 5:30 PM with a talk given by our featured speaker.
- Immediately after the talk, there will be time to picnic at tables provided outdoors while the sky darkens for telescope viewing. Bring your own food, or order dinner from the food truck that will be available.
- Once it is dark, attendees can view the night sky until 11:30 PM through both the 60- and 100-inch telescopes (you can leave at any point in the evening).
- The Los Angeles Astronomical Society will have its telescopes set up around the grounds for viewing different night sky objects.
